Canyon de Chelly, named by the Spaniards who did not understand that its name Tséyi' was the Diné (Navajo) name for canyon. The Navajo used to seek refuge during the colonization period, due to its difficulty of access. Massacres took place especially during the 19th century, of women, elders and children having found refuge in the canyon.
Anasazi housing (ancestors of the Pueblos, and maybe most of South-West current tribes)
